I've been using my laptop to record my voice with an external mic. However, I found that there's a noise on the background when I record and plugged the laptop's power cable at the same time.
I've searched online and it seems that the noise sounds like a ground loop noise. But only a mic (doesn't plug into the outlet) and the power cable (plug into the outlet) are connected to the laptop, so it confuses me that it doesn't seem to be able to create a ground loop.
There's no noise when I unplug the power cable, so I'm sure it's not the microphone problem. So if anyone could help it would be great! Thanks!
